Compare bus, train, and flight for Aachen to Geneva

Omio recommends booking the flight as it is the most popular option from Aachen to Geneva among Omio's users. If you are prioritising price, take the bus, with an average ticket price of $102 For those with little time, consider booking a flight, which has an average total journey time of 4h 36m. If you are seeking to minimise your carbon footprint, the train is your best option, with estimated CO2 emissions of 0.2 - 0.5kg. Average ticket prices depend on the travel mode: a bus costs an average of $102, while a flight costs an average of $534.

Distance: 316 miles (509 km)

The distance from Aachen to Geneva is approximately 316 miles (509 km).
The average frequency per day from Aachen to Geneva is:
  • Around 61 flights per day.
  • Around 4 buses per day.
  • Around 4 trains per day.

However, we recommend checking specific travel dates for your route between Aachen and Geneva as scheduled services by bus, train, and flight can vary by season or day of the week.

These are the most popular departure and arrival points from Aachen to Geneva:
  • Buses mostly depart from Aachen, Henricistraße / Kühlwetterstraße and arrive in Geneve, Place Dorcière.
  • Trains mostly depart from Aachen Hbf and arrive in Geneva station.
  • Flights mostly depart from Dusseldorf Airport and arrive in Geneva International Airport.

Most travelers need at least three days in Geneva to see the main sights at a comfortable pace. If you want day trips or a slower itinerary, consider adding extra time.
In Geneva, explore the charming Old Town with its narrow streets and historical buildings, enjoy a boat cruise on Lake Geneva for stunning views of the city and Alps, and visit the International Red Cross and Red Crescent Museum. Discover the vibrant Carouge district known for its bohemian atmosphere, and relax at Bains des Pâquis. Don't miss the Jet d'Eau fountain, St. Pierre Cathedral, Parc des Bastions, Palais des Nations, and Patek Philippe Museum.
Typically, 2 to 3 days are sufficient to explore Geneva's main attractions, including the Jet d'Eau, the United Nations Office, and the Old Town, while also enjoying the city's parks and museums.
